That’s right, darling—Tedde Moore, the Canadian-born legend who absolutely *slayed* her iconic roles, has passed away at 79. And we have to say, the way she went out? Totally on-brand for someone as classy as her.

The legendary actress, best known for her unforgettable work in the beloved classic “A Christmas Story,” bid farewell on Wednesday, surrounded by loved ones both near and far. According to reports, Moore was battling multiple sclerosis for years—a condition that would’ve broken lesser mortals, but this queen?
